    Overview

    The Siembra Latinos Fund prioritizes grants that support specific causes within the Latino community, with an overarching goal of enhancing opportunities for individuals and families. The grant program focuses on:

    1. Education: Supporting programs aimed at vocational and technical career achievement for students, aiding English Learners in achieving fluency, and improving critical thinking as well as collaboration skills among high school and college students to solve real-world problems. It also focuses on integrated academic supports to prepare high school graduates for college and their careers.

    2. Health: Addressing COVID-19 related grief, self-advocacy in mental health, and guidance in navigating health services for those with limited access. It also supports community health programs focused on prevention and health promotion that mitigate isolation and the social-emotional impacts of the pandemic.

    3. Economic Development: Funding is directed towards fostering business development, retention, growth, and increased access to education, training, and entrepreneurship programs.

    Types of requests considered include program support for the expansion or refinement of existing programs, new initiatives showing potential for impact and sustainability, emergency or special circumstances support, as well as operating support for organizations with a proven track record of community benefit.
